## Deployment

Greenhouse controller Mossbeam v2.3. Fixes sensor drift: humidity probes now recalibrate hourly against the reference cell. Deploy to all bays; stagger by zone, 15 min apart. Rollback is a single flash of the prior image. Verify drift under 2% on the Bay C dashboard before sign-off. Do not ship with stale calibration constants. The controller must boot with the configuration values below.

config for hahaf-kafof:
[wenys]
host = wenys.torvahq.corp
user = wenys_svc
database = wenys_prod

Management Meeting Minutes — Reseller Programme

Present: Dena Forsgate, Ollie Rennick, Priya Calloway.

Quick recap: the Fernlight reseller programme is tracking ahead of plan — 14 partners signed versus the 10 we'd hoped for. Margins are a bit thinner than modelled, mostly down to the tiered discount we offered early joiners. Ollie will tighten the discount bands before the next intake. Where we want to take the programme next is covered in the note below.

board note of yahip-tadug: Headcount on the Zorath team goes from 9 to 100 by the end of April. Gross margin on Zorath came in at 10 percent against a plan of 20 percent.

ALERT: Renderfold PDF invoice renderer failing on batch jobs since the 14:20 deploy. Roughly 30% of invoices render with blank line-item tables; totals still correct. Root cause suspected in the new font-embedding path. Customer-facing impact: resend queue growing. Mitigation: rollback candidate build staged, awaiting release manager sign-off. Do not promote the current build to the Ostermark region. Error samples, affected tenant counts, and the rollback checklist are collected on the internal triage page that follows.

dashboard of tawef-yageg = https://jira.torvaworks.corp/deploy/merge_requests/board/settings/issue/settings/build/86c86b97dff3e2041bd6f497

### Account Recovery — Catalogue Import (Lintwood)

Quick one for review: when the Lintwood catalogue import wipes a patron's session table, the recovery flow re-seeds accounts from the nightly snapshot. Check that the importer skips locked accounts — last time it didn't. To rerun recovery against staging you'll need the vault passphrase, which is appended just below.

recovery phrase for yafof-tajof: julmir-kelax-julvan-holath-belvan-holir-ralael-ralvan-ralath-julvan-silmir-istmir-kaswyn-ulamir